Understanding Nerve Hooks
Nerve hooks are specialized surgical instruments used primarily in the field of medicine, particularly during procedures involving nerves and the nervous system. These versatile tools are essential for manipulating and exploring nerves with precision, ensuring that surgical interventions can be carried out safely and effectively. The design and functionality of nerve hooks make them indispensable in neurosurgery, orthopedic surgery, and other medical specialties where surgical access to delicate nerve tissues is required.
Types of Nerve Hooks
Nerve hooks come in various designs and sizes, each tailored for specific surgical applications. Understanding the different types can help healthcare professionals choose the right tool for their needs:
- Standard Nerve Hooks: These are basic models used for general purposes in nerve manipulation.
- Angled Nerve Hooks: Designed for accessing nerves at challenging angles, providing enhanced visibility and control.
- Micro Nerve Hooks: These are ultra-fine tools ideal for delicate procedures requiring minimal invasiveness.
- Self-Retaining Nerve Hooks: These hooks maintain position without additional support, allowing surgeons to focus on other tasks.
Applications of Nerve Hooks
Nerve hooks are applied in a variety of medical scenarios, showcasing their effectiveness as surgical tools. Key applications include:
- Neurosurgery: Used for accessing and manipulating nerves during brain surgeries and spinal procedures.
- Orthopedic Surgery: Employed to identify and preserve nerves while performing joint replacements or other orthopedic manipulations.
- Peripheral Nerve Surgery: Essential in surgeries dealing with peripheral nerve injuries or reconstructions.
- Research and Education: Used in teaching settings for instructing surgical techniques that involve nerve handling.
Features and Advantages of Nerve Hooks
The design features of nerve hooks contribute greatly to their effectiveness in surgical applications. Key features and advantages include:
- Precision Tips: The finely crafted tips of nerve hooks allow for accurate and delicate manipulation of nerve structures.
- Diverse Shapes: Availability in various shapes and lengths facilitates navigating complex anatomical structures with ease.
- Durability: Made from high-quality stainless steel or specialized materials, nerve hooks resist corrosion and wear, ensuring longevity.
- Easy Sterilization: Designed to withstand autoclaving, nerve hooks can be easily sterilized for safe surgical practice.
